So, what is Be My Eyes? It's an application for Android and IoS

(NO! The Android version is still being developed)

where you can help a visually impaired person, in many languages.

The app, of course, is accessible for the person who needs help.

When you open the app, you choose if you want to help or need the help,

then the app will connect both sides.

When someone who needs help, for example, to cook a stroganoff, and need to know

When someone who needs help, for example, to cook a stroganoff, and need to know

if the can he is holding has condensed sweet milk or buttermilk

Oh, I got it!

Or, for someone who is colorblind, they might need help to choose a sweater, because they don't know which one is blue and which one is red

- Oh, "Be my eyes", now I got it! To see things for them, be their eyes. (He was thinking about the name in Portuguese, not in English)

Or, if you are going to take a medicine, and you know how you can´t mix the bottles ...

Or the expiration date of something that is in your closet

Anyway, it has a thousand uses for someone who is visually impaired, sometimes at home and alone

It's easy to use. The person double touch the screen, the app opens, and is already connected

You, for example, on the helper side, don't need to keep the app open

I see

After the installation, you choose a language

and the app will call you when someone needs help.

It opens a chat between the person who needs help and the people who are registered to help in that language

Then the person asks for your help to "see" something. You become their eyes for a moment, then it's done! Thank you and goodbye.

I understood, you help in your own language

You choose: English, Portuguese, there is a list of languages you can volunteer to help

- Gee, super simple. You pay nothing. Just with your time?

Nothing

Only time

No, you don´t pay for anything, it only takes your time, and usually no more than a minute

It's that easy. And if you can´t answer, someone else will, for sure

There are 36,000 blind or visually impaired persons registered in the app

"I Want To Think It Over" What Every Salesperson Must Do To Avoid This - Duration: 5:16.

- No five words are more frustrating to a salesperson

than the words "I want to think it over."

The bad news is that this is your fault,

if you're hearing it as a salesperson.

The good news is that there are

a couple of steps that you can take

to avoid the vast majority of these sales situations.

Strangely, it doesn't require some fancy ninja

headlock close technique.

What I'm going to show you is going to change the way

that you not only think about "think it overs,"

but it's also going to change the way you think

about sales more generally.

In this video I'm going to show you

what every salesperson must do

to avoid those words "I want to think it over."

Check it out.

Number one.

Stop trying to get yes.

Let's first get very clear

on what a "think it over" actually is.

Think is over's really are just a nice way

of the prospect telling you no.

They don't do this because they have some super nice agenda,

but really because they're feeling a lot of pressure

in the selling situation to tell you yes.

This was caused by you.

If a prospect feels pressure to say yes,

then that means that the salesperson was putting pressure

on the prospect to say yes in the first place.

Moving forward,

instead of trying to get a yes from a prospect,

focus on trying to determine

if there's actually a fit in the first place.

This means that the outcome of a no is also okay.

Number two, help them determine the value.

One of the reasons that a prospect would say

"I need to think about it"

or wouldn't want to buy from you in the first place

is that they're simply not seeing the value

in what you're offering.

The state they're currently in

versus the outcome that you're offering them in the future

isn't a compelling enough distance

to cause them to want to invest in your offer.

This means that during the sales process.

You need to spend a lot of time helping the prospect

actually calculate the actual value

of solving their challenges.

Thus investing in your solution.

That means asking a question such as

if you were able to solve the challenges

that you mentioned today,

what would that mean to your organization?

A little hint,

be sure to get a dollar value answer.

Number three.

Get a budget before giving price.

One of the most common reasons that sales fall off track,

even when a prospect is in fact eager

and interested in buying from you,

is that there was never really clarity around a budget.

Salespeople for years have been telling me

that they can't get a budget.

This is simply not true though.

My response is always the same.

If you're having trouble getting a budget

it means that you're asking for a budget incorrectly.

There are a number of ways to do it

but I'll share with you two very simple

but tactical approaches to getting a budget.

The first part is that after having gone

through their challenges,

you just want to ask a simple question

like do you have a budget for this project?

They may or may not.

They may or may not be forthcoming with that information.

But let's just say that the prospect says no.

They don't have a budget.

Then you revert to the range budget question.

That would sound something like this:

George, based on what you've told me,

a solution to your challenges

would range anywhere from $10,000 to $50,000.

Where in that range could you see yourself,

if at all?

That's a much easier question to answer.

Number four.

Stop trying to close them.

It's time to take the pressure off the situation

at all times.

Any time a prospect feels pressure to buy from you

they're going to be very likely

to give you an "I want to think it over."

You need to be totally comfortable that some sales

are going to end in a no.

In fact, that's really great

because if you get no's instead of think it overs,

you're ultimately going to be getting

far more yeses in the long run.

You don't need those high-pressure closing techniques.

You just need to ask good questions

throughout the selling situation

to get on the same page with the budget.

If you do this, there's no formal close.

All you're doing is just determining

the logical next step.

There is what every sales person must do

to avoid "I want to think it over."

Why Do Bees Buzz? | ScienceTake | The New York Times - Duration: 2:32.

All bees buzz when they fly.

Some bees buzz to communicate to each other.

They seem to buzz a little louder when they are agitated.

Caught in a tube, for instance.

Bumblebees and a few others buzz for another reason

that has nothing to do with communication,

flight or distress.

You can see them on a flower, buzzing like mad,

until they are covered with a shower of pollen.

What are they doing?

If anyone knows, it's Professor Hollis Woodard,

an entomologist with a particular passion

for bumblebees.

Probably one of the coolest things that bumblebees do

and one of the ways that they use buzz

is in buzz pollination — or sonication.

Where a foraging worker will visit a flower

and she'll vibrate on a flower.

The buzz comes from the vibrations

of the muscles in the bee's thorax.

Those muscles are used to move the wings,

but also to produce the buzz without flying.

The anthers contain pollen,

but the pollen is locked away inside.

And the bee needs to come along

and vibrate on the flower</font>

to cause it to actually release its pollen.

We know that a lot of that pollen

that's released actually lands on the bee

and the bee can then scrape the pollen,

put it in her pollen basket, if she's a bumblebee,

and then she can carry it back home.

-Ah, they eat the pollen?

-They eat the pollen!

But, the primary reason that you see bees

out collecting pollen

is so that they can bring it back to their nest

and provision their nest.

So many flowers give bees food.

In exchange for that, bees help

many flowering plants species move their pollen

around in the landscape.

The best case scenario for a plant

is if their pollen gets picked up by a bee

and gets moved to another flower

that is of the same species

that is farther away.

Some of our food crops

depend on buzz pollination.

If we didn't have bees coming along

and buzz pollinating them,

we wouldn't be able to produce these foods

at the scale that we do.

5 Foods to Avoid While Traveling | And What to Do If You Get Sick! - Duration: 4:57.

Hi there, it's Ernest from Trip Astute. In this video, we're going to be discussing

the top five foods that I avoid while traveling, and some tips in case you do get sick.

(light chiming music)

Eating is one of the best parts of traveling. Trying new foods and flavors

is something that I look forward to whenever I visit and explore a new place.

Unfortunately though, it's also an easy way to throw your digestive system into

panic, especially if you're not careful. The general rule is "boil it, cook it, peel

it, or leave it!", but obviously that means you'll be missing a lot of what makes

exploring a new place so special. So, in this video, I wanted to share my top five

items to avoid consuming when traveling. It's not a definitive list, but it's the

top things that I avoid when I'm away from home.

Number one: Raw fruits and vegetables. While I love to eat raw fruits and

vegetables, I typically avoid them when traveling to places where tap water may not

be safe. Basically, you want to avoid items that have any chance of being

washed in contaminated water or handled with unclean utensils. Also, it's not just

salads. Once I ordered a fish sandwich in a remote part of Panama and it had a

bunch of raw vegetables in it. I ate it, and I didn't get sick, but it was

definitely a dilemma. Since it was the last day of my trip, I decided to take

the risk, but I probably would have avoided it otherwise. Number two:

Buffets. There are a lot of things that can go wrong with a buffet. You can have

food that's been sitting out for a long time, as well as contamination with flies.

It's not to say that I never eat at a buffet. But I would avoid anything that

looks like it's been sitting out for too long or in a place with questionable

sanitation. Number three: Shellfish. This is where I've gotten sick in the past.

While clams, mussels, and oysters can be delicious, they are notorious for having

a really short shelf life. While a lot of travelers will tell you to avoid

seafood in general, I still eat fish, especially when traveling to coastal

areas. But I avoid the shellfish. It's just not worth it for me. Number four: Ice.

This is an easy one to overlook. When ordering a drink, whether it be a soft

drink or with alcohol, it may be wise to specifically ask for no ice. Also, you may

want to avoid blended drinks when possible. Like with salads, you want to

avoid exposure to unsafe water. There is a little trick that a lot of travelers

will use though. If the ice has a hole in it, then it's typically safe to drink since

it's from an ice factory that's likely using filtered water. Number five: Street

vendors. This one really depends on where you are visiting. In places like Thailand,

the street food is often rated as being extremely safe and clean to eat. In other

places, like India or Central America, it might not be as safe. If you do decide to

try street food, then I would advise one where others, including locals, are eating.

Also, make sure the food is cooked on the spot and the menu is small and simple.

You basically want to make sure that you're getting fresh ingredients that

hasn't been sitting out for too long. And those are my top five things to avoid

eating and drinking. If you look online, there are a ton of articles on things

you should avoid, and I'll include a few in the video description. While you can be

hardcore and avoid everything, it's really about measuring the risk while

still being able to explore and embrace the experience. If you do happen to get

sick from eating or drinking while traveling, I would recommend carrying two

over-the-counter medications with you. One is Pepto Bismol, or any generic

version of it. Pepto Bismol is my first line of defense if I experience any

travelers diarrhea and usually is able to stabilize my stomach and gut. The

second medicine that I carry is Imodium. I'm not a doctor,

but my experience is that imodium stops diarrhea, which is what I need if I know

I'll be sitting on a plane or have limited access to a restroom. In the US,

you can also get a prescription for an antibiotic like Cipro before traveling.

It's handy to have in case you need to treat a bacterial infection. While you

should avoid taking antibiotics whenever possible, it's nice to have in the event

that you get really sick. What food and drinks do you avoid when traveling? You
